Indian economy to sustain high growth momentum in coming quarters: CEA Nageswaran

Speaking virtually at an event organised by the Indian Chamber of Commerce, Chief Economic Adviser (CEA) V. Anantha Nageswaran on Saturday (August 30, 2025) said the high growth momentum exhibited in the first quarter of the current fiscal is expected to continue in the coming quarter as well, with a downward bias emanating from high…
